摘 要:在分析和研究快速细化算法和OPTA细化算法基础上,针对快速细化算法细化不彻底和OPTA算法模板设计的缺点提出了对OPTA细化算法的改进,设计了新的细化算法模板。经过实验证明改进的OPTA细化算法能够满足细化的基本要求,既保证了细化结果线条的单像素宽,又保持了原有图像线条的连通性,同时线条细节特征没有丢失,使细化结果得到了较大改善。On the basis of analyzing and studying the quick thinning algorithm and the OPTA thinning algorithm, it is known that the thinning result of the quick thinning algorithm is not single pixel and the templates of the OPTA thinning algorithm is not optimized. So a method to overcome the shortcomings of the OPTA thinning algorithm is proposed and some thinning templates are redesigned. Through experiments, the new algorithm has been proved to fulfill the basic needs of the thinning algorithm, it guarantees that the width of the line is single pixel, maintains the connectedness of the original image. The effects of the new algorithm are evidently improved.
